My go-to for cinema times BUT the more showings, the smaller the text, often illegible. Used to show about 7 times max. before text shrinkage, now max.5, and one film today has 21 showings, so it’s invisible - unusable - therefore listings delivered are incomplete and frustrating. Labels were added (in 2018, I think) to each and every showing time, making many more listings illegible. Now get 5 times listed before text shrinks - that’s if only “2D” and “3D” are used. Badly formatted and difficult to visually scan. “Captain Marvel” has 21 showings today in Cineworld Dublin (2019-03-10). Listings are almost invisible and cannot be zoomed conveniently with iOS accessibility zoom switched on, and even when you do that, the text size is beyond usable even with the 1125 pixel wide iPhone X! Example: “Wed 1st [that much would be full size] 15:202D 15:503D 16:202D 16:50IMAX 3D 18:10ISENSE 19:20IMAX 2D 19:502D 20:00Subtitled 20:20IMAX 3D 21:502D [those times would be too tiny to read]”.
